Urban Farming and Community Gardens
Embrace the power of urban agriculture by starting an urban farm or community garden. This project will involve cultivating fresh produce in urban spaces, such as vacant lots or rooftop gardens. By growing organic fruits and vegetables, you will provide a local source of healthy food, reduce food miles, and promote environmentally friendly practices. Community gardens can also serve as educational hubs, teaching residents about gardening, nutrition, and sustainable living. Food Rescue and Redistribution Network
Tackle food waste and hunger simultaneously by establishing a food rescue and redistribution network. This project involves collecting surplus food from restaurants, grocery stores, and farms and redistributing it to shelters, food banks, and families in need. By rescuing perfectly good food that would otherwise go to waste, you will contribute to both environmental sustainability and food security.
